Itaipu Binacional Awards $165 Million Contract to CIE-Elecnor Consortium for 500-Kilovolt Transmission Line in Paraguay

Researched by Industrial Info Resources (Córdoba, Argentina)--Itaipu Binacional, the bi-national entity between Brazil and Paraguay that owns and operates the 14-gigawatt (GW) Itaipu Hydro Power Plant, awarded Lot 3 of the 500-kilovolt (kV) transmission line project to a consortium between Consorcio de Ingenieria Electromecanica S.A. (CIE) (Asuncion, Paraguay) and Elecnor Transmissao de Energia S.A. (Sao Paulo, Brazil) on September 23, 2011.

The works awarded include the complete supply and installation of an overhead, 500-kV transmission line that will connect the substation on the right side of the Itaipu Hydro Power Plant (SEMD) and the substation under construction in Villa Hayes, a city 30 kilometers from Asuncion.

CIE-Elecnor Consortium's proposal was $165.7 million, higher than Transminor Abengoa-Intesur Consortium's proposal of $159.22 million, but the evaluation committee decided to declare CIE-Elecnor the winner, since its material supply will be fully produced in the Mercosur area.

According to the bidding schedule, the transmission line should be completed in 14 months.

The project is a key part of Paraguay's development plans, since it will allow the country to double the energy drawn from Itaipu Hydro Power Plant, where the electricity demand increases 100 megawatts (MW) a year and the national transmission network is operating at its maximum nominal capacity.

Last May, Itaipu Binacional awarded a $120 million contract to a consortium formed by ABB Ltda. (San Pablo, Brasil) and CIE for Lots 1 and 2. The first lot includes the construction of a grassroot 500/220/66/23-kV substation in Villa Hayes, while the second lot includes the upgrade and expansion of the 500-kV Margen Derecha substation.
